On my 535d I have BT option since beginning.

I had always paired all BT phones I tried without major problems and obviously without SMS functionality that is not provided with no phones at all (except hard wired such as CPT...).
The differences in functionality are : phone book transferred or phone book not transferred.
According to my experience models that can transfer phone book quickly and flawlessly are : Motorola V3, Motorola V3i, Motorola Z3, Motorola V3xx ONLY ONCE, Samsung Z510, Nokia N73.
Bad experience on phone book transfer : Nokia E61, some LG, some Nokia
But here we are:
I bought a Motorola V3xx (very similar to V3i but UMTS such as Samsung Z510) and before the pairing procedure will finish (after both request of id code) the V3xx hanged up always ON no way to switch off trough their key.
Only way to switch off the phone was to remove battery.
After repositioning battery no way to switch it ON. ONE DEAD ( I'm still waiting repaired or new one from Motorola) .
I thought to a defective unit , it happens.
In the meantime no problem at all with my old V3i and Z510.
I bought another V3xx from a friend asking him to try a pairing together : no problem V3xx paired perfectly and his phone book (resident on his SIM) transferred.
I changed the SIM and I added a micro SD memory (1G : the phone was perfectly paired but... no phone book transfer.
With phone book on Sim or on phone, with micro SD on or not no way to transfer phone book.
Try to un-pair and pair again several times ,only result that during a try V3xx hanged up again , but that time removing and reinstalling battery worked fine.
My son have a new Xmas Nokia E61, I try to pair it: pairing was fine but no phone book transfer, but after that operation it was impossible to completely switch off the E61 (screen all blank but always powered) it was necessary to remove battery and the switching on normally, but again no switch off possible . He resolved the problem with two operation:
1) with Nokia procedure provided for Soft Software Reset
2) saying me: strictly forbidden to play again with his E61 , may be E60 BMW worst enemy of Nokia E61 :'(

Now I'm searching a Motorola UMTS phone with none of these problem on E60 535d BT (CIP 20, dec2004 build, sat nav pro).
Any suggestion ?

Had anyone any kind of similar problems ?
In other italian forum someone suggested that new UMTS phone have BT 2.0 and E60 may have BT 1.x, and may be that Motorola in implementig BT 2.0 forgot some back compatibility among various levels of protocol.
